漏洞如何修复?掌握这些关键步骤让你的系统更安全
文章导读
在数字化时代,网络安全漏洞已成为企业和个人面临的重大威胁,无论是软件漏洞、系统配置错误,还是人为操作失误,都可能被黑客利用,导致数据泄露、系统瘫痪甚至经济损失。漏洞如何修复才能确保系统安全?本文将详细介绍漏洞修复的关键步骤、最佳实践及预防措施,帮助您构建更安全的网络环境。
什么是漏洞修复?
漏洞修复(Vulnerability Remediation)是指通过技术手段和管理措施,消除或缓解系统中存在的安全缺陷,防止恶意攻击者利用漏洞入侵系统,漏洞可能存在于操作系统、应用程序、网络设备或人为操作流程中,修复漏洞是网络安全防护的核心任务之一。
漏洞修复的主要目标
- 防止未授权访问:阻止黑客利用漏洞获取敏感数据或控制系统。
- 降低攻击面:减少系统暴露在外的风险点。
- 符合合规要求:满足行业法规(如GDPR、等保2.0)的安全标准。
漏洞修复的关键步骤
漏洞发现与评估
漏洞修复的第一步是识别系统中的安全弱点,常见方法包括:
- 漏洞扫描:使用自动化工具(如Nessus、OpenVAS)检测系统漏洞。
- 渗透测试:模拟黑客攻击,发现潜在漏洞。
- 安全审计:检查代码、配置和日志,寻找异常行为。
漏洞评估标准(CVSS评分)
| 风险等级 | CVSS评分 | 修复优先级 |
|----------|----------|------------|
| 高危 | 9.0-10.0 | 立即修复 |
| 中危 | 4.0-8.9 | 尽快修复 |
| 低危 | 0.1-3.9 | 酌情修复 |
漏洞修复方案制定
根据漏洞类型选择合适的修复策略:
- 补丁更新:安装官方发布的安全补丁(如Windows Update、Linux软件包更新)。
- 配置调整:修改系统或应用的安全策略(如关闭不必要的端口、限制权限)。
- 代码修复:开发人员修复应用程序中的逻辑漏洞(如SQL注入、XSS漏洞)。
修复实施与验证
- 测试环境验证:先在非生产环境测试修复方案,避免影响业务。
- 分阶段部署:逐步应用修复措施,确保系统稳定性。
- 漏洞复测:修复后重新扫描,确认漏洞已消除。
持续监控与改进
漏洞修复不是一次性任务,需建立长期的安全管理机制:
- 定期扫描:每周或每月执行漏洞扫描。
- 威胁情报:关注最新的漏洞公告(如CVE、CNVD)。
- 应急响应:制定漏洞应急响应计划(如零日漏洞的快速修复)。
常见漏洞修复方法
操作系统漏洞修复
- Windows系统:通过Windows Update安装最新补丁。
- Linux系统:使用
apt-get update && apt-get upgrade(Debian/Ubuntu)或yum update(CentOS/RHEL)。
Web应用漏洞修复
| 漏洞类型 | 修复方法 |
|---|---|
| SQL注入 | 使用参数化查询(Prepared Statements)或ORM框架 |
| XSS跨站脚本 | 对用户输入进行HTML编码(如使用OWASP ESAPI) |
| CSRF跨站请求 | 添加CSRF Token验证 |
| 文件上传漏洞 | 限制文件类型、检查文件内容、存储至非Web目录 |
网络设备漏洞修复
- 防火墙/路由器:更新固件,关闭Telnet等不安全协议。
- 数据库:限制远程访问,启用加密(如MySQL的SSL/TLS配置)。
漏洞修复的最佳实践
- 自动化漏洞管理:使用SIEM(安全信息与事件管理)工具监控漏洞。
- 最小权限原则:仅授予用户必要的权限,减少攻击面。
- 备份与灾难恢复:修复前备份关键数据,防止修复失败导致数据丢失。
- 安全意识培训:员工是安全链中最弱的一环,定期进行安全培训。
FAQs(常见问题解答)
Q1:为什么漏洞修复后系统仍然被入侵?
A1:可能原因包括:
- 修复不彻底(如只修补部分漏洞)。
- 存在未知漏洞(零日漏洞)。
- 攻击者已植入后门,需彻底排查。
Q2:如何应对零日漏洞(0-day)?
A2:零日漏洞尚无官方补丁,可采取以下措施:
- 启用WAF(Web应用防火墙)拦截攻击。
- 临时关闭受影响的服务。
- 关注厂商公告,及时应用缓解方案。
参考文献
- 《信息安全技术 网络安全漏洞管理规范》(GB/T 30276-2020)
- 《网络安全等级保护基本要求》(等保2.0)
- 中国国家信息安全漏洞库(CNVD)公告
- OWASP Top 10(2021版)
通过科学的漏洞修复流程,企业可以有效降低网络安全风险。安全是一个持续的过程,而非一次性任务,定期评估、快速响应、持续改进,才能构建真正安全的系统。
上一篇:修复漏洞是一个系统性的过程,需要从漏洞发现、分析、修复到预防的全流程管理。以下是分步指南
栏 目:漏洞分析
本文地址:https://fushidao.cc/wangluoanquan/49487.html
您可能感兴趣的文章
- 02-01如何高效扫描网站漏洞?全方位防护指南揭秘
- 01-31网站安全大作战,如何全面检测并修复网站漏洞?
- 01-31漏洞如何修复?掌握这些关键步骤让你的系统更安全
- 01-29修复漏洞是一个系统性的过程,需要从漏洞发现、分析、修复到预防的全流程管理。以下是分步指南
- 12-02漏洞 自动化脚本 论漏洞和自动化脚本的区别
- 12-02手把手教你如何构造Office漏洞POC(以CVE-2012-0158为例)
- 12-02Python 爬虫修养-处理动态网页
- 12-02看一眼就中毒 详解微软lnk漏洞(快捷方式漏洞)
- 12-02黑客通过Paypal可传输恶意图像
- 12-02Swagger JSON高危漏洞被发现 Java/PHP/NodeJS/Ruby或中招
阅读排行
推荐教程
- 12-02看一眼就中毒 详解微软lnk漏洞(快捷方式漏洞)
- 12-02黑客通过Paypal可传输恶意图像
- 02-01如何高效扫描网站漏洞?全方位防护指南揭秘
- 12-02Python 爬虫修养-处理动态网页
- 12-02Swagger JSON高危漏洞被发现 Java/PHP/NodeJS/Ruby或中招
- 12-02漏洞 自动化脚本 论漏洞和自动化脚本的区别
- 12-02手把手教你如何构造Office漏洞POC(以CVE-2012-0158为例)
- 01-31网站安全大作战,如何全面检测并修复网站漏洞?
- 01-31漏洞如何修复?掌握这些关键步骤让你的系统更安全
- 01-29修复漏洞是一个系统性的过程,需要从漏洞发现、分析、修复到预防的全流程管理。以下是分步指南
